Rena H. Schulz1938-2008
Rena Kay Horton Schulz, 69, of Louisville died Sunday, Aug. 3, 2008, at Baptist East Hospital.
Born Nov. 2, 1938, in Eubank, Ky., she was the daughter of the late George Washington Horton and the late Ruby Osborne Horton Bryant. She was a homemaker and, for 19 years, a server at Tumbleweed Restaurant in Louisville.
Rena Kay was a member of the Midlane Presbyterian Church in Louisville where she was active in her Sunday School class and the Fellowship Committee. Rena never met a stranger and was an active member of the YMCA in Louisville.
Survivors include her husband, Frank E. Schulz, two sons, Glenn Rice and Keith E. (Sabrina) Rice Sr., and a daughter, Angel Kay Spooner, all of Louisville; five sisters, Judy (George) VanArsdall, Patsy (Lennie) Shepperson, Margaret Horton and Katie (Sonny) Collier, all of Danville, and Charlene Antle of Moreland; two brothers, John T. (Nancy) Horton of Florence, Ky., and George (Tammy) Horton of Nicholasville; and six grandchildren, Keith E. Rice Jr., Joshua W. Rice, Zackary M. Spooner, Brandon L. Spooner, Noah S. Spooner and Halley K. Spooner. She was predeceased by her sisters, Ann Finn, Sandra Wimberly, Connie Horton and Carlene Horton.
